Syrup Shack Diner

A non-commissioned project to design a touch-screen menu system for an American Diner. The brief was to come up with a design that would appeal to the family market, consider usability as it was intended for a table top touch screen system where the order could be placed at the table, paid for and sent through to the kitchen easily and minimising assistance from diner staff.

The menu also included a duke box funtion where music could be chosen by individual customers and added to the restaurant queue. The colours reflect 1950's American cartoons, giving the family appeal and the layout is bright, consistent and easy to use. Extensive usability testing was carried out on the system with a working 'walk-through' being programmed in Flash.
